Tokyo Police Arrest Four in Shinjuku Robbery Preparation Probe

Japanese authorities have detained four additional individuals in connection with a suspected robbery preparation incident in Tokyo’s Shinjuku district, bringing the total number of arrests to six.

Investigation expands as suspects, including a minor, are detained following initial arrests on May 21

Japanese police have arrested four additional suspects, including a 17-year-old minor, in connection with a robbery preparation incident in Shinjuku, Tokyo. The arrests follow the detention of two 23-year-old suspects on May 21, who were suspected of loitering near a jewellery buyer’s office with intent to rob. Two other suspects remain at large. Reports indicate that some suspects were recruited via social media.

The investigation began on May 21 when two 23-year-old men were detained for loitering near a jewellery buyer’s office in the Shinjuku district. Police suspected the individuals were preparing to commit robbery. The subsequent arrests of four additional suspects, including the minor, expand the scope of the police inquiry into the alleged plot.

According to reports cited by NHK News Japan, the recruitment of some suspects occurred through social media platforms. This detail suggests a potential reliance on digital channels for coordinating the alleged criminal activity, although the exact extent of online involvement remains part of the ongoing investigation.

The legal status of the individuals is currently defined by their association with the robbery preparation case. Police have not yet filed formal charges, and the specific roles of each suspect within the alleged group are not fully detailed in public reports. The involvement of a minor in the case has prompted authorities to proceed with caution, ensuring that the age of the suspect is accurately reported without stigmatising language.

As the investigation continues, police are actively searching for two suspects who remain at large. The total number of individuals arrested in connection with this specific incident cluster now stands at six. Authorities have not provided further details on the potential timeline or the specific nature of the planned robbery.
